**Handover: export retries (Quillbatch)**

New folks: failed exports land in the dead-letter table, not the queue. The retry daemon sweeps every 10 minutes; manual retries go through the ops CLI, never direct SQL. Backoff is exponential, capped at six attempts. Anything still failing after that pages whoever's on call. Don't touch the sweep interval without telling Marit. The daemon reads its settings from the block below.

service settings:
[casax]
port = 6379
team = rusir
host = casax.zemvarhq.corp
region = outer-4
access_code = ac_9808ce
timeout_ms = 1500

## Payroll Export Change — Release Steps

Starting with release 4.18, Wagecrest exports payroll in the new columnar `.wgx` format instead of flat CSV. Before cutting the release, run the converter smoke test against last month's sandbox data and confirm the Ledgermole downstream importer accepts the header block. The smoke test calls our internal Paystream validation service, so you'll want its current key handy, which is right below.

gateway credential: kto3_qfe

**Configuration — Gridwright**

Gridwright, our crossword generator at Puzzlarch, reads all settings from a `.env` file in the project root. Set `GRIDWRIGHT_DICT_PATH` to your local wordlist and `GRIDWRIGHT_MAX_FILL_SECONDS` to a sensible timeout (we use 30). Please keep this file out of version control. The clue-suggestion service also requires authentication; on the final line, add its API key:

env line for kaguf-hahop: COURIER_KEY29=2e2fa9479f98362396e2c28f86fc9

### Step 4 — Enable log sampling on Mistralbook

The Mistralbook notification service emits roughly forty log lines per request, which overwhelmed the aggregator during the Fennery migration rehearsal. This step enables head-based sampling so support can still trace individual requests while cutting volume by about ninety percent. Apply the change during a quiet window, then watch the ingest dashboard for fifteen minutes before proceeding to Step 5. The sampling settings you need to apply are listed below.

config for tawif-bagef:
[sorwyn]
team = sorys
access_code = ac_9ba40c
host = sorwyn.ordingrid.local
port = 5000
owner = aldok.quenion
peer = belath.paliqcloud.local